The girls have full reign over the greenhouses now that I've picked everything. They go in there to get away from the wind and have a perma dry place to dustbath. It's perfect for the winter months.

People have asked us if the chickens go on the road. They don't. They'll get close like this at times, but as soon as a vehicle is coming they flee, and then slowly work their way back again, and then flee again. So don't worry bout my babes.
